Regarding the "!Fantasy_chimney.png" character chip.

If you use the "stomping animation" event option, a different image will be mixed in.

The character chip animation is a set of three, so why are there only two?

Developer

the step animation won't work because it's an 8 frame animation. 

You can see the frame order on the right side. 

So you need to use a turn direction command for a smooth animation.
